Hi there AdobeIf an image has been mirrored and/or rotated e.g. by setting an EXIF tagOrientation : Mirror horizontalthe loupe tool in the preview panel does not reflect the change. For images with a lot of text this is suboptimal.Version of Adobe Bridge: 15.0.2.432Steps to reproduce the issues: preview an image with an EXIF tag set e.g. Orientation: Mirror horizontalOperating System: W10 22H2 19045.5608Expected result: image is displayed in mapped orientationActual result: image is displayed in original unmapped orientation

I copied about 200 photos to my Mac from a camera whose date and time were exactly 1088 days, 3 hours, 21 minutes, and 28 seconds behind the correct date and time. I discovered that the user interface to set the "Date Time Original" field in the Exif metadata only allows the user to adjust the time on a batch of photos by a maximum of 24 hours, 59 minutes, and 59 seconds. I had to adjust the batch of photos by 3 hours, 21 minutes, and 28 seconds, and then tediously go through and change the date on each and every photo individually by 1088 days. The user interface should have a field where the user can also specify a number of days to shift, or failing that, a much larger number of hours (in my case, 1088 days x 24 hours, or 26,112 hours).(MacBook Pro 16-inch Nov 2023, Sequoia 15.2, Bridge 15.0.2.432)
When a video clip, say a .mp4 file, is selected from the list in my Content panel, and I hit spacebar to play it in full-screen mode, nothing happens. This is on my MacBook Pro 16-inch Nov 2023 running Sequoia 15.2.I can work around this by selecting a static image, say a .jpg file, that is also in the list in my Content panel, hit spacebar to display it in full-screen mode, and then use the up-arrow or down-arrow to get to the .mp4 file. The video then plays in full-screen mode as expected.(MacBook Pro 16-inch Nov 2023, Sequoia 15.2, Bridge 15.0.2.432)
